This is what my husband has been doing every morning for the past 3 or 4 weeks. It helps a great deal but is not destroying the colonies. So today I went out with a couple of sprayers full of a mix of neem, Dr. Bronner's soap and maxi crop and sprayed down a lot of plants and cuke beetles.

We will see how this one two punch works

maureen bostock wrote:
I have had excellent success with cucumber beetles vacuuming them up with a batterypowered hand held vacuum. It has a hard plastic casing in which the beetles are collected. When I have done all the rows, I dump them in soapy water (soap breaks surface tension) and they drown. I am sure this would work with harlequins as well. Investment: $40.00, Value: Priceless.
